My motor went awhile without running. It's used as a kicker. Now it won't start. Checked spark (good), changed gas no luck. Removed and cleaned carb. and noticed bowl was empty. Filled the bulb and installed the carb, engine ran fine until the bowl emptied then it died. The fuel to the pump is unrestricted. Is the pump bad. It runs good until the bowl empties. I didn't see any obvious defects in the pump diaphram. <br />Any help would be reatly appreciated. thanks

Re: Nissan 5hp Fuel pump problem?

Take the hose off of the carb, that goes to the fuel pump, and spin the motor over. If fuel starts coming out of the hose, then the fuel pump is good. If no fuel, then pump is bad. Also it could be that the needle valve is not opening up and not letting gas into the carb.
